Electronics, communication equipment, and the transportation sector are just a few of the businesses that use anti-static foam rolls as packaging. Due to its exceptional capacity to shield delicate objects from electrostatic discharge (ESD), which can harm electronic components and lead to malfunctions, it is used.
It’s crucial to make sure that electronic parts and equipment are secured throughout the shipping procedure. With its protected, cushioned core and conductive exterior, anti-static foam rolls offer a secure location to transport or store delicate components. The conductive exterior shields them from ESD events, while the foam composition absorbs shock to safeguard them from unintentional bumps and bangs.
Choosing anti-static foam rolls with the proper thickness and density is essential for meeting your unique needs for protection. To ensure that the packing solution is customised to safely protect its contents, foam rolls are offered in a range of densities and thicknesses. The amount of shock absorption that foam provides is determined by its thickness, and its level of support is determined by its density, which is expressed in pounds per cubic foot (lbs/ft3). Without adding extra bulk to the packing, choosing a foam with the right density and thickness can assist prevent harm to delicate electronics.
Anti-static foam rolls are frequently utilised in factories in addition to being used to safeguard electronics during transportation. For instance, ESD measures are routinely taken when working on electronic components during manufacture to prevent any potential harm. The components can be set up on the foam surface with the aid of an anti-static foam roll, creating a secure area to work in.
Anti-static foam rolls can also be used to line shipping crates or trays for goods once they have been made or fixed. The foam rollers offer a solid foundation and aid in keeping goods in place while being transported. Furthermore, the foam rolls can be altered to meet your unique requirements and product designs.
